- Citizens'_War_Memorial abstract "The Citizens' War Memorial (alternate: Soldiers' War Memorial) in Cathedral Square, Christchurch, is one of the two major memorials in the city to World War I. It is located immediately north of ChristChurch Cathedral. The annual Anzac Day service is held there. It is a Category I heritage structure registered with the New Zealand Historic Places Trust.".
